1/150 : 2 = 1/200: X
NeTakaya

Answer:

The value of X is X=\frac{3}{2}

Step-by-step explanation:

Given : \frac{1}{150} : 2=\frac{1}{200} : X

To find : The value of X ?

Solution :

\frac{1}{150} : 2=\frac{1}{200} : X

Converting ratios into fraction,

\frac{\frac{1}{150}}{2}=\frac{\frac{1}{200}}{X}

\frac{1}{150\times 2}=\frac{1}{200\times X}

Cross multiply,

200X=300

X=\frac{300}{200}

X=\frac{3}{2}

Therefore, The value of X is X=\frac{3}{2}

Given the coordinate T(8, -4), find the location of T after a dilation using a scale factor of 0.4.
vagabundo [1.1K]

The new coordinate will be T'(3.2 , -1.6) .

<h3>What is the meaning of Dilation ?</h3>

Dilation is the transformation that changes the size of the object without changing its shape .

If a coordinate point is (x,y) and a dilation of scale factor f is applied then the new coordinates will be (fx ,fy)

The coordinate given in the question is T(8, -4)

The scale factor is 0.4

The new coordinate is

T'( 0.4 * 8 , 0.4 * (-4))

T'(3.2 , -1.6)

Therefore the new coordinate will be T'(3.2 , -1.6)
